### 2/5 — Could be great, but…

*2026-08-31, version 13.62.1*

Prior to using this app, I have mostly used Waze and Googlemap. I decided to try out TomTom after buying the ‘Tom’ device, which I think is a very handy gadget, but requires TomTom to be installed on your phone. 

So two stars from me. I’ll start with the positives. It’s free to use, the layout is very clear/clean and I like some of the features. For example, if you’re going through an average zone, TomTom will show you what your average speed actually is and adjust accordingly if you slow/speed up. It’ll give you some breakdowns at the end of your journey and paired with the ‘Tom’ it’ll warn you of any speed cameras or hazards. It has shown me better routes, often finding shortcuts missed by Waze and Googlemaps. The two occasions I ignored its diversion directions, I ended up regretting it after double checking with Waze and going with that. 

The negatives - whilst the app looks great and works very well (when it’s working), there are problems. The biggest problem being that if you’re doing a long drive, the app will stop working. It’ll still be on your screen and still showing your speed. But it’ll stop showing you whatever the speed limit is and lose track of where you actually are, often showing you as in the middle of a field next to the road and not moving. The arrival time will not be accurate and overall it becomes useless. You can get it to work again, but only if you end the navigation and start all over again - dangerous and hopeless if you’re already speeding down a motorway. This is an absolute fail and needs fixing if anyone is to take the app seriously. (And just for clarity, both my iPhone and the app itself are fully updated). 
The next major issue with the app are locations themselves. Again, an absolute fail and renders the app utterly useless. Some locations simply aren’t recognised in the app. My home isn’t recognised and so I have to set the centre of my village as my ‘home’, despite being nowhere near my house. On a drive recently to a nature reserve, the app decided to take me down a farm track nowhere near the nature reserve itself. Its inability to locate locations has left me unable to rely on it and I’ve had to revert back to Waze or Googlemaps to be sure I’m going to the correct locations. When driving to a new location, I now don’t bother with TomTom and instead go for Waze, because I can’t trust TomTom to recognise the location, or take me to the correct location. 

Overall I actually think TomTom has a huge amount of potential. I think features on some of the other apps aren’t particularly helpful and I think TomTom has the balance just right. Showing you your speed through and average zone for example - really useful! I’d far rather use TomTom and paired with ‘Tom’, it could be absolutely brilliant. But until these major issues are fixed, it’s completely unreliable. I believe they used to charge people to use this app - how?! Please fix the app asap! Until it is fixed, I will be returning to Waze, which I can rely on to work.

### 1/5 — Broken trash as of August 2026

*2026-08-05, version 12.81.6*

August update: they “updated” the app. Really?? Well they did t try it on CarPlay, at least not Subaru. The map STILL FLIES ALL OVER when you hit the move button. Want to try to move around the little town you are in? Hahahahah! Fool!!! No. The map will fly off to half a mile away. Don’t bother to zoom
I. Or out, it won’t help. they still haven’t fixed the ability to put in multiple stops. Still trash!
“ 

It’s very frustrating and sad that this company, which made wonderful standalone GPS devices that function very well, and which makes in-car navigation on multiple different brands (e.g. Subaru, Jeep, etc) that function pretty well, makes such a horrible standalone phone app! The stars they do earn relate to the fact that 1) this is free with no ads. And 2): it does well with giving you the traffic colors on the map, so you can see around you and your destination any bad traffic. It also does well with giving you lots of options for marking road issues. As a phone map app it’s Ok- Lacks some significant items like making multiple stop routes. But the integration to CarPlay for Apple is horrendous. you can NOT zoom in and out using your figures on a pinch function nor swipe the map: you have to use the arrows to move and the plus/minus buttons to zoom. AND you can’t get to those without tapping a small little area on the screen. The June 2026 update had now broken the movements: it shifts the map in MASSIVE chunks, which often mean nowhere near your route (e.g. routing in PA, but arrows move the map to NJ). So you cannot have a fine level of control anymore. it’s horrible! When the app shows you the route Options. there are these big thick blue lines which also erase details so you don’t know necessarily what some of the roads are that it wants to take you on. Oh and you cannot zoom in on the map to see the route options - it only zooms to the end point no matter what! so, if you want to figure out what roads of the particular route option are, you have to choose one route and THEN move around the map, and if you don’t like that, you have to CANCEL the route and select a new one through the entire “search” process of putting an address in and looking for routes. For those who want to search for stops along the route, or multiple stops, you cannot! it is one stop only! (Unlike Apple Maps) if you need to go anywhere else or see somewhere along the route, you have to END your route, search for what you want, select it, and route to it, and then when there put your original destination back in. unbelievable! I don’t like that I have to pay for my in-car system navigation map, updates, and traffic, but I’m about to based on just how bad this app actually helps me. I’m not a big fan of the Apple app, but that actually is some degree quite a bit better than this one.
